Door repair services involve fixing and restoring both the functionality and appearance of exterior and interior doors. These services typically address issues such as damaged frames, broken hinges, misaligned doors, or problems with locks and handles. Skilled service providers assess the condition of the door, identify the root cause of the problem, and perform necessary repairs to ensure the door operates smoothly and securely. Whether a door has become difficult to open or close, or shows signs of wear and tear, professional repair helps restore safety and convenience for homeowners.
Common problems that door repair services help solve include warping, cracking, or rotting wood, as well as dents and scratches that compromise the door’s integrity. Additionally, issues with weatherstripping, broken locks, or faulty hinges can lead to security concerns or energy loss. Service providers can replace damaged parts, realign misaligned doors, or install new hardware to improve performance. Regular repairs can also prevent further damage, extend the lifespan of the door, and maintain the overall appearance of the property.

The overview below groups typical Door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or door repairs, such as fixing a loose hinge or replacing a handle, generally range from $50 to $200.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the lower or higher ends.
Mid-Range Fixes - More involved repairs like repairing or replacing door panels or locks tend to cost between $200 and $600. These projects are common and represent the typical scope of work handled by local contractors.
Door Replacements - Replacing an entire door, including installation, usually costs between $600 and $1,500 for standard models. Larger, more complex doors or custom installations can reach $2,500 or more, though these are less common.
Full Door System Overhauls - Complete door system upgrades, including frame, hardware, and insulation, can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or higher. Such extensive projects are less frequent and often involve high-end materials or custom work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of door repair services do local contractors provide? Local contractors can handle a variety of door repairs, including fixing damaged panels, addressing misalignment, replacing broken hinges, and repairing or replacing locks and handles.
How can I tell if my door needs repairs? Signs that a door may need repair include difficulty opening or closing, visible damage or warping, unusual noises during operation, or issues with locks and hardware.
Are there different repair options for interior and exterior doors? Yes, repair methods can vary depending on whether the door is interior or exterior, with exterior door repairs often focusing on weatherproofing and security features.
